MeV linear accelerator

Definition / meaning of MeV linear accelerator

A machine that uses electricity to form a stream of fast-moving subatomic particles. This creates high-energy radiation that may be used to treat cancer. Also called linac, linear accelerator, and mega-voltage linear accelerator.

